Project Supervisor
Location: Cumbria, Barrow in Furness
Price / Salary: £40000 - £47000/annum
Report this ad
 

Unify HQ are delighted to be recruiting for a Project Supervisor to join a global FM contractor in Barrow in Furness, Cumbria

Hours: 07.30 - 16.30 Monday to Friday 40 hours per week

Company benefits:

* 25 days holiday + Bank holidays

* Private Healthcare after 6 months service

* Company sick pay

Job Purpose:

The driver for developing contract value optimisation, tracking divisional performance of the services business, will continue to develop and implement a consistent commercial framework for the projects business and develop/adapt and implement a proactive approach to risk management reducing risk to as low as reasonably practical. The role will include leading the assessment and delivery of projects in line with Group policies and procedures

Duties / Responsibilities:

* Liaison with commercial / technical / operational management in order to develop contractor lists and develop new business prospects.

* In conjunction with the Contracts Manager, prepare annual business plans identifying opportunities and development of the small projects operations.

* Preparation of programmes, method statements and risk assessments.

* Procure labour / materials and sub-contractors in accordance with buying procedures ensuring waste and costs are minimised.

* Liaise with Management to keep them informed of contract progress and issues that may affect the running of the contract.

* Based upon current and projected project activity as identified in the annual business plan, develop an in house cost effective and multi skilled team of Technicians appropriately to the needs of the project business.

* Management and close supervision of Staff and sub-contractors.

* Knowledgeable and up to date in matters relating to Health and Safety and statutory requirements including CDM Regulations and ensure compliant at all times.

* Maintain accurate project administration files and costs (financial records).

* Preparation of a monthly report for the Contracts Manager detailing project activities.

* Attendance at monthly internal meetings.

* Provide operational support as necessary to other parts of business.

* Any other reasonable duties as requested.

* Support Statutory and Unplanned Outages by completing a reasonable amount of paid overtime, including weekends. This may temporarily involve duties different to your normal role

Person Specification:

* Educated to HNC / HND Standard (or equivalent)

* Extensive experience in similar role

* Knowledge of key operational management disciplines, e.g. quality control, work planning methods

* Capable of managing a portfolio in excess of £500k per annum

* IT literacy (word processing, spreadsheets and project management tools)

* Valid full driving licence, desirable clean

* Good sound knowledge and understanding with commercial and contractual issues
